Disa

Disa is a deaf FeLv+ kitty that came to us from a local rescue group in June of 2013.  Such a beautiful girl, but as feral as they come, hiding most of the time and hissing at anyone who came near.  Disa got sick in 2015 and required some quarantine time in a kennel.  She soon became quite acustomed and looked forward to the volunteers who provided her wet food that contained her medicine.  Disa was soon a very different girl!  She now is a social butterfly and has two boyfriend kitties, she also tolerates a bit of petting and she no longer hisses at the site of people.  She has come a long way in three years!
